We ahve a spiral bound copy of Brown's Pure effect, but it has no publisher or date listed. I see there is a current edition in hardcover, and this item has the same picture on its cover. It also has 182 p. with an additional page advertising his caricature work with 6 full color examples.

Would this be the first edition? I believe the latest is the 3rd.

Gene, that does sound like a true first edition. I believe the first edition, self-published by Derren, includes one or two sections that were withheld from the later editions (I have never had a first edition to check!). Can you list the contents so I can compare it with our current edition? You should do well with this on eBay if it does indeed include the excised material. We get requests for it all the time! Never had one (I'm guessing he only printed 100 or so...)

Thanks for the reply. The contents are:

A Moment of Your Exceptionally Valuable Time

Part One - (Practical)
-Making Contact
-Working With the Spectator
-Risk and Delight

Part Two - (Magical Artistry)
-"Zamiel's Card"
-A Three Card Routine
-"Magicall"
-Magno Conatu Magnus Nugas

Part Three - (Direct Mindreading)
-Invisible Compromise and an Approach to Mind Reading
-Communicative Subleties
-"Lift"
-"Smoke"
-"Plerophoria"
-"Perfect Coin Reading"
-"Transformation"
-Two Verbal Card Forces
-"Reminiscence"

Final Thoughts

Thank-Yous

(followed by the one page caricature advert)

Gene, thanks for taking the trouble to list the contents. I've checked against the current edition and the two items that are only in the first edition are "Lift" and "Remniscence." You should do very well with this on eBay, should you chose to list it there. Good luck!
